Awards Presented in Houston
Dozens of distinguished scientists and students received awards and scholarships during the 2008 ASA-CSSA-SSSA Annual Meetings in Houston, TX. View the Awards Program (PDF)>>

Experts
We have more than 11,000 members, and can put you in touch with agronomists, crop scientists, soil scientists, to comment on current topics, including policy, research, and the sciences. To locate an expert, contact Sara Uttech, 608-268-4948.
Meetings & Events
Members of the media are invited to attend our meetings with complimentary registration to credentialed journalists, PIOs, and NASW members. Free access to the abstracts, and recorded presentations are also available.
